About the NAC in the Ukrainian government's own words.

In support of UNO Convention on children's rights that was ratified by Verkhovna Rada of Ukraine on February 27, 1991, our state recognized importance and necessity to give priority to the placement of orphaned children and children deprived of parental care in families over their placement in residential-educational institutions that was widely spread during long period of time. Adoption is one of the most important activities in the system of social protection of childhood.

In 1996 the Centre of adoption was created. It is determined that the Centre is a public institution that facilitates placement of orphaned children and children deprived of parental care in the families of the citizens of Ukraine and foreigners by way of adoption.

Joint committee on adoption of children who are the citizens of Ukraine by foreign citizens was created by order (No. 34/2002) of January 17, 2004 of the President of Ukraine in order to coordinate activities of central and regional bodies of executive power on adoption of orphaned children and children deprived of parental care by foreigners and effective protection of rights of such children. Ministry of Education and Science of Ukraine ensures organizational support of its activity.

Minister of Education and Science of Ukraine is the head of the Committee; members of the Committee are the deputy heads of the ministers of related ministries, officials of other central bodies of executive power.

Legal organizational mechanism of adoption in Ukraine is based on the principles that meet the requirements of international standards. They are as follows:


  • every child has right to grow up in the family;


  • priority shall be given to domestic adoption;


  • international adoption shall be considered as alternative only when adoption in the native country of child is impossible;


  • all questions that can appear during adoption procedure shall be decided in accordance with current legislation of Ukraine;
